IBM Tivoli Directory Server, Version 6.3

Installing Tivoli Directory Server: use InstallShield GUI or operating system utilities, but not both

On AIX®, Linux, and Solaris systems, the InstallShield GUI installation program installs the same packages that are installed by the operating system utilities, but sometimes it groups multiple packages under a single feature listed in the InstallShield GUI installation panels. For example, the C Client 6.3 feature includes the base client package and the bit-client package (32-bit client for a 32-bit client operating system and 64-bit client for a 64-bit client operating system).

Note:
When installing Tivoli® Directory Server on AIX, Linux, or Solaris systems using the InstallSheild GUI, ensure that the install_tds.bin command is run from a command-line program that supports GUI.

If you mix the two types of installation, you might not install all of the correct packages for a feature. Therefore, install using either the InstallShield GUI installation program or operating system utilities, but not both. (For example, if you install Tivoli Directory Server initially using the InstallShield GUI installation program and you later want to add a feature that you did not install, be sure to use the InstallShield GUI again, rather than operating system utilities.)
